The Georgia Tech Yellow Jackets (8-11, 2-6 ACC) are 5.5-point favorites as they try to stop a four-game losing streak when they host the Virginia Tech Hokies (8-10, 3-4 ACC) on Wednesday, January 22, 2025 at Hank McCamish Pavilion. The game airs at 7:00 PM ET on ESPNU. The matchup’s over/under is 143.

Georgia Tech statistics, trends and more

As the home team

  • Against the spread, Georgia Tech has performed better at home, covering five times in 13 home games, and one time in five road games.
  • The Yellow Jackets have hit the over on the over/under in a higher percentage of games at home (46.2%) than road games (40%).

Recent trends

  • The Yellow Jackets have seen a decrease in scoring lately, racking up 73.3 points per game in their last 10 contests, 1.6 points fewer than the 74.9 they’ve scored this season.
  • The last 10 games have seen Georgia Tech allow 73.9 points per game, the same as its season-long average.
  • The Yellow Jackets’ 7.6 made three-pointers per-game average over their last 10 games are less than the 7.7 they average on the season, but those 10 games have seen a higher percentage of three-point shots made, 36.5% compared to their season-long percentage of 34.0% from deep.

Virginia Tech statistics, trends and more

As the away team

  • Against the spread, Virginia Tech was better at home (9-6-1) than away (2-9-0) last season.
  • Looking at the over/under, Hokies games went over seven of 16 times at home (43.8%) and seven of 11 on the road (63.6%) last season.
  • When moneyline underdogs last year, the Hokies won a higher percentage of games at home (1-1) than on the road (1-7).

Recent trends

  • The Hokies have performed better offensively over their past 10 games, averaging 71.9 points per contest, 1.5 more than their season average of 70.4.
  • Over its past 10 games, Virginia Tech is surrendering 74.4 points per game, 1.3 more points than its season average (73.1).
  • The Hokies are making 8.1 three-pointers per contest over their last 10 games, which is 0.5 more than their average for the season (7.6). Likewise, they own a better three-point percentage over their previous 10 contests (39.5%) compared to their season average from beyond the arc (35.8%).

What is the Spread?

If you are a golfer or have ever played on a bowling team, think of a point spread like a handicap. It is a way for two teams of differing abilities to play each other on equal footing.  The better team, and the favorite in the game, gives a certain amount …
